Seguro para exposiciones temporales, or temporary exhibition insurance, is a critical aspect of protecting valuable art pieces and artifacts during their travel and display at various venues. Whether it is a museum hosting a special exhibition, an art gallery showcasing new works, or a cultural institution organizing a temporary display, having the proper insurance coverage is essential to mitigate risks and ensure financial protection.

Temporary exhibitions are an integral part of the art world, allowing institutions to share valuable collections with a broader audience and bring attention to unique artists and artworks. However, these exhibitions also come with inherent risks, including damage, theft, and liability issues. Therefore, it is crucial for organizations to secure reliable insurance coverage to protect themselves and their collections.

One of the primary purposes of temporary exhibition insurance is to provide financial protection in the event of unforeseen circumstances that can result in damage or loss of artworks. This coverage typically includes protection against theft, accidental damage, and vandalism, as well as coverage for transportation-related risks during the exhibition period.

When considering temporary exhibition insurance, institutions should work with experienced insurance providers who specialize in art and cultural property insurance. These providers will understand the unique risks associated with art exhibitions and can tailor coverage to meet the specific needs and requirements of each institution. They can also provide valuable advice and guidance on risk management strategies to minimize potential losses and ensure a successful exhibition experience.

In addition to traditional insurance coverage, some institutions may also consider additional coverage options, such as terrorism insurance or special event insurance, depending on the nature of the exhibition and its location. These additional coverages can provide extra protection against specific risks that may not be covered under standard policies.
